§ 242.304. FEES; FUNDS.
Official statutory text
(a) The executive commissioner, in consultation with the department, by rule shall set reasonable and necessary fees in amounts necessary to cover the cost of administering this subchapter. The executive commissioner by rule may set different licensing fees for different categories of licenses.
(b) The department shall receive and account for funds received under this subchapter. The funds shall be deposited in the state treasury to the credit of the general revenue fund.
(c) The department may receive and disburse funds received from any federal source for the furtherance of the department's functions under this subchapter.
